A Victorian silver vinaigrette, by Nathaniel Mills, Birmingham 1846, shaped rectangular form, with traces of gilding, the hinged cover engraved with a river scene, with a paddle steamer and a town and bridge in the background, the base with engine-turned decoration and a vacant cartouche, a scroll foliate pierced grille, length 3.5cm, approx. weight 0.5oz. Provenance: A Private Collection. Purchased from Christie's, South Kensington, 2 May 1995, lot 166.
